Economy Mechanics and Market Dynamics
Roblox Galactic economies rely on layered currencies, trade routes, and player run markets. Designers model supply, demand, and inflation to keep star systems stable over long play sessions.
Transaction fees, market taxes, and embargo rules shape how alliances form and dissolve. Clear documentation of these mechanics helps communities anticipate price shocks and plan large scale infrastructure projects.

Architecture and Server Infrastructure
Roblox Galactic titles typically run on a distributed server mesh that handles physics, chat, and economy logic. Regional data centers reduce latency for players across continents and enable failover during peak events.
Monitoring dashboards track ship counts, event throughput, and resource usage. Automated scaling policies spin up additional nodes when large battles or market crashes drive sudden load spikes.
Community Governance and Player Roles
Many Galactic Roblox communities establish councils that review rule changes, mediate disputes, and approve new star systems. Transparent voting records and clearly defined powers help maintain trust over time.
Moderators, developers, and content creators collaborate through public roadmaps and design sprints. This open process encourages contributors to align with long term galactic strategies rather than short term exploits.
